类org.springframework.beans.factory.support.BeanDefinitionDefaults源码实例Demo

下面列出了怎么用org.springframework.beans.factory.support.BeanDefinitionDefaults的API类实例代码及写法,或者点击链接到github查看源代码。

/**
 * Return the default settings for bean definitions as indicated within
 * the attributes of the top-level {@code <beans/>} element.
 */
public BeanDefinitionDefaults getBeanDefinitionDefaults() {
	BeanDefinitionDefaults bdd = new BeanDefinitionDefaults();
	bdd.setLazyInit(TRUE_VALUE.equalsIgnoreCase(this.defaults.getLazyInit()));
	bdd.setAutowireMode(getAutowireMode(DEFAULT_VALUE));
	bdd.setInitMethodName(this.defaults.getInitMethod());
	bdd.setDestroyMethodName(this.defaults.getDestroyMethod());
	return bdd;
}
 
/**
 * Return the default settings for bean definitions as indicated within
 * the attributes of the top-level {@code <beans/>} element.
 */
public BeanDefinitionDefaults getBeanDefinitionDefaults() {
	BeanDefinitionDefaults bdd = new BeanDefinitionDefaults();
	bdd.setLazyInit("TRUE".equalsIgnoreCase(this.defaults.getLazyInit()));
	bdd.setAutowireMode(getAutowireMode(DEFAULT_VALUE));
	bdd.setInitMethodName(this.defaults.getInitMethod());
	bdd.setDestroyMethodName(this.defaults.getDestroyMethod());
	return bdd;
}
 
源代码3 项目: lams   文件: BeanDefinitionParserDelegate.java
/**
 * Return the default settings for bean definitions as indicated within
 * the attributes of the top-level {@code <beans/>} element.
 */
public BeanDefinitionDefaults getBeanDefinitionDefaults() {
	BeanDefinitionDefaults bdd = new BeanDefinitionDefaults();
	bdd.setLazyInit("TRUE".equalsIgnoreCase(this.defaults.getLazyInit()));
	bdd.setDependencyCheck(this.getDependencyCheck(DEFAULT_VALUE));
	bdd.setAutowireMode(this.getAutowireMode(DEFAULT_VALUE));
	bdd.setInitMethodName(this.defaults.getInitMethod());
	bdd.setDestroyMethodName(this.defaults.getDestroyMethod());
	return bdd;
}
 
源代码4 项目: blog_demos   文件: BeanDefinitionParserDelegate.java
/**
 * Return the default settings for bean definitions as indicated within
 * the attributes of the top-level {@code &lt;beans/&gt;} element.
 */
public BeanDefinitionDefaults getBeanDefinitionDefaults() {
	BeanDefinitionDefaults bdd = new BeanDefinitionDefaults();
	bdd.setLazyInit("TRUE".equalsIgnoreCase(this.defaults.getLazyInit()));
	bdd.setDependencyCheck(this.getDependencyCheck(DEFAULT_VALUE));
	bdd.setAutowireMode(this.getAutowireMode(DEFAULT_VALUE));
	bdd.setInitMethodName(this.defaults.getInitMethod());
	bdd.setDestroyMethodName(this.defaults.getDestroyMethod());
	return bdd;
}
 
/**
 * Return the default settings for bean definitions as indicated within
 * the attributes of the top-level {@code <beans/>} element.
 */
public BeanDefinitionDefaults getBeanDefinitionDefaults() {
	BeanDefinitionDefaults bdd = new BeanDefinitionDefaults();
	bdd.setLazyInit("TRUE".equalsIgnoreCase(this.defaults.getLazyInit()));
	bdd.setDependencyCheck(this.getDependencyCheck(DEFAULT_VALUE));
	bdd.setAutowireMode(this.getAutowireMode(DEFAULT_VALUE));
	bdd.setInitMethodName(this.defaults.getInitMethod());
	bdd.setDestroyMethodName(this.defaults.getDestroyMethod());
	return bdd;
}
 
/**
 * Set the defaults to use for detected beans.
 * @see BeanDefinitionDefaults
 */
public void setBeanDefinitionDefaults(@Nullable BeanDefinitionDefaults beanDefinitionDefaults) {
	this.beanDefinitionDefaults =
			(beanDefinitionDefaults != null ? beanDefinitionDefaults : new BeanDefinitionDefaults());
}
 
/**
 * Set the defaults to use for detected beans.
 * @see BeanDefinitionDefaults
 */
public void setBeanDefinitionDefaults(@Nullable BeanDefinitionDefaults beanDefinitionDefaults) {
	this.beanDefinitionDefaults =
			(beanDefinitionDefaults != null ? beanDefinitionDefaults : new BeanDefinitionDefaults());
}
 
源代码8 项目: lams   文件: ClassPathBeanDefinitionScanner.java
/**
 * Set the defaults to use for detected beans.
 * @see BeanDefinitionDefaults
 */
public void setBeanDefinitionDefaults(BeanDefinitionDefaults beanDefinitionDefaults) {
	this.beanDefinitionDefaults =
			(beanDefinitionDefaults != null ? beanDefinitionDefaults : new BeanDefinitionDefaults());
}
 
/**
 * Set the defaults to use for detected beans.
 * @see BeanDefinitionDefaults
 */
public void setBeanDefinitionDefaults(BeanDefinitionDefaults beanDefinitionDefaults) {
	this.beanDefinitionDefaults =
			(beanDefinitionDefaults != null ? beanDefinitionDefaults : new BeanDefinitionDefaults());
}
 
/**
 * Return the defaults to use for detected beans (never {@code null}).
 * @since 4.1
 */
public BeanDefinitionDefaults getBeanDefinitionDefaults() {
	return this.beanDefinitionDefaults;
}
 
/**
 * Return the defaults to use for detected beans (never {@code null}).
 * @since 4.1
 */
public BeanDefinitionDefaults getBeanDefinitionDefaults() {
	return this.beanDefinitionDefaults;
}
 
源代码12 项目: lams   文件: ClassPathBeanDefinitionScanner.java
/**
 * Return the defaults to use for detected beans (never {@code null}).
 * @since 4.1
 */
public BeanDefinitionDefaults getBeanDefinitionDefaults() {
	return this.beanDefinitionDefaults;
}
 
/**
 * Return the defaults to use for detected beans (never {@code null}).
 * @since 4.1
 */
public BeanDefinitionDefaults getBeanDefinitionDefaults() {
	return this.beanDefinitionDefaults;
}
 
 同包方法